Paul's parcels was set up as a food poverty prevention group. We do this by supplying free food at four community fridges on a weekly basis. We visit the small town of Shotts and the villages of Harthill, Salsburgh, and Allanton. We supply our families with fresh veg, dairy and protein as well as ambient food. Toiletries are also supplied, should they be needed. We have a strong ethos, that everyone, no matter their circumstances, deserves to have access to a healthy balance diet. We support, on average 200 people on a weekly basis with our community fridges and we do not limit how often a family visits us. Food poverty/Insecurity is often part of the many strains, within a household, that cannot be rectified by one visit and we will support a family for as long as they need us. At each community fridge, throughout the year we also supply a free lunch and in the winter we launch our 'Meet, heat and eat' project that provides a healthy, homecooked meal.
Objectives: The objects for which the group is established are: a) the prevention or relief of poverty in Shotts and surrounding areas in particular but not exclusively by providing emergency food supplies to individuals in need and/or charities, or other organisations working to prevent or relieve poverty. b) to provide services to people who have need of them by reason of their age, ill-health, disability, financial hardship or other disadvantage by signposting them to additional support services.
